Introduction to parallel processing
computing tech that involves simultaneously executing multiple
tasks in parallel
aims to divide
larger problem into smaller and solve them
concurrently
improves overall performance efficiency of amp system
can beapplied to indu processors w in single computer to
cluster
of interconnected comp
ability to process tasks simultaneously rather than sequentially
Adj
Improvedperformance reduced execution time
processing units
Increased scalability more
by adding
Enhanced
fault tolerance
Real time processing capability like simulations signal processing etc
Disady
, algos complex
PARALLEL PROCESSING IN UNI PROCESSOR
Icomponents
CPU
Main mem
I O
subsystem
a common synchronous bus architecture fr Ito m m
If
it is a
system w single prolesson perform two or more task
sim
Parallelism increases effiency reduces time of protessing
types Pipline Processing
not in syllabus
Array
Vector in J
and
Funclassifatinof comp
proposed
by Mikael J Flynn
categories comp architecture based on no
of instruction streams
data streams they can handle concurrently
, SISD
use Em
Single atiosingleData
Single stream of instruction operates on a
single
stream
of
data
represents tradional henna
CPU executes single stream inst
of on
single piece
of data atating
do inherent parallelism
Ihave
system falls into this class
Most conventional uniprocessor
SingleinstructioniMultipleDatafsinDI
executes single instruction on
multiple data elementssimultaneou
sanest applied to Lata simously
used in
vectyprocessing multi apps
GPL uses starch to
aubatation
computing tech that involves simultaneously executing multiple
tasks in parallel
aims to divide
larger problem into smaller and solve them
concurrently
improves overall performance efficiency of amp system
can beapplied to indu processors w in single computer to
cluster
of interconnected comp
ability to process tasks simultaneously rather than sequentially
Adj
Improvedperformance reduced execution time
processing units
Increased scalability more
by adding
Enhanced
fault tolerance
Real time processing capability like simulations signal processing etc
Disady
, algos complex
PARALLEL PROCESSING IN UNI PROCESSOR
Icomponents
CPU
Main mem
I O
subsystem
a common synchronous bus architecture fr Ito m m
If
it is a
system w single prolesson perform two or more task
sim
Parallelism increases effiency reduces time of protessing
types Pipline Processing
not in syllabus
Array
Vector in J
and
Funclassifatinof comp
proposed
by Mikael J Flynn
categories comp architecture based on no
of instruction streams
data streams they can handle concurrently
, SISD
use Em
Single atiosingleData
Single stream of instruction operates on a
single
stream
of
data
represents tradional henna
CPU executes single stream inst
of on
single piece
of data atating
do inherent parallelism
Ihave
system falls into this class
Most conventional uniprocessor
SingleinstructioniMultipleDatafsinDI
executes single instruction on
multiple data elementssimultaneou
sanest applied to Lata simously
used in
vectyprocessing multi apps
GPL uses starch to
aubatation